A Guide to Stress-Free Drop-Offs and Happy Pickups

Sending your furry friend to daycare for the first time can be exciting — and a little nerve-wracking! Whether it’s a full-day stay or just a few hours, making sure your dog is prepared can make the experience smoother for both of you.

🧠 Why Preparation Matters

Dogs are creatures of habit. When they’re introduced to a new environment (like a dog daycare), some may be excited, while others may feel nervous or overwhelmed.

Proper preparation helps your dog:

  • Feel more secure and confident
  • Adapt more easily to the new environment
  • Enjoy the experience from the first day

✅ Pre-Daycare Checklist

Before your pup’s first visit, go through this simple list:

1. Vaccinations Up to Date

Make sure your dog has:

  • Rabies
  • DHPP
  • Bordetella (kennel cough)
  • Tick & flea prevention

2. Basic Socialization & Commands

Your dog doesn’t need to be a training champion, but it helps if they know:

  • “Sit,” “Stay,” “Come”
  • How to behave around other dogs
  • Not to jump excessively

If your dog is shy or anxious, consider a few short trial visits to help them ease in.


3. Meal Prep (If Needed)

For full-day stays, you can bring your dog’s food in a labeled container with feeding instructions. We stick to your dog’s regular schedule to keep their tummy happy.


4. Pack Essentials

Here’s what to bring:

  • Collar with ID tag
  • Leash
  • Any medications (with instructions)
  • Favorite toy or blanket (optional)

5. Pre-Drop-Off Walk

Take your dog for a short walk before coming. This helps burn off excess energy and encourages a potty break, making the transition smoother.


6. Stay Calm & Confident

Dogs pick up on your emotions. A quick, calm goodbye works best — no long, emotional farewells. You’re coming back soon!

💡 Pro Tip: Start Small

Consider doing half-days or once-a-week visits to start. Gradual exposure builds confidence and reduces anxiety.
